首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Ionic 2应用程序中从TSLint中排除node_modules

在Ionic 2应用程序中,可以通过配置TSLint来排除node_modules文件夹。TSLint是一种用于静态代码分析的工具,可以帮助开发者发现并修复潜在的代码问题。

要在Ionic 2应用程序中排除node_modules文件夹,可以按照以下步骤进行操作:

  1. 打开项目根目录下的tslint.json文件。该文件用于配置TSLint规则和选项。
  2. 在tslint.json文件中,找到"exclude"字段。如果该字段不存在,可以手动添加。
  3. 在"exclude"字段中,添加一个正则表达式,用于匹配要排除的文件或文件夹。对于排除node_modules文件夹,可以使用以下正则表达式:
  4. 在"exclude"字段中,添加一个正则表达式,用于匹配要排除的文件或文件夹。对于排除node_modules文件夹,可以使用以下正则表达式:
  5. 这将告诉TSLint在代码分析过程中忽略node_modules文件夹。
  6. 保存tslint.json文件。

通过以上步骤,Ionic 2应用程序中的TSLint将不再分析和报告node_modules文件夹中的代码问题。

Ionic是一个用于构建跨平台移动应用程序的开源框架,它结合了Angular和Apache Cordova技术。Ionic提供了丰富的UI组件和工具,使开发者能够快速构建高质量的移动应用程序。

TSLint是一个用于TypeScript代码的静态分析工具,它可以帮助开发者遵循一致的编码风格和最佳实践。通过配置TSLint,开发者可以定义代码规则,并在构建过程中自动检查代码是否符合这些规则。

排除node_modules文件夹是因为该文件夹通常包含第三方库和依赖项,这些代码不应该由开发者直接修改。因此,在代码分析过程中排除node_modules可以提高分析效率并减少误报。

腾讯云提供了一系列云计算产品和服务,包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的信息和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【开发指南】(六)Ionic3目录结构理解开发

ionic的命令行生成为原始的静态html页面,并存放在www目录(见上图所示),也就是说www开发过程是不需要理的,可以任意删除。...package.json: node安装模块时的依据文件,在里面配置的内容,执行npm install命令后会生成到node_modules目录。...上述说的是ionic3的开发结构及其理解,现在要说的是最重要的文件夹src——angular2及以上的开发结构理解,主要为八项: app:入口文件夹; app -app.component.ts:入口页的业务逻辑...另外它们的名字也是可变的,只是基于约定大于配置的概念,而且利用ionic-cli命令行生成文件,如ionic g pipe date会生成到上述默认文件夹名称,所以建议保持一致。...而压缩打包混淆等都是ionic框架内部处理了,所以我们只需专注于页面的实现,那最最简单的开发步骤就是,pages里面新建一个页面,写好逻辑,然后app.module.ts添加配置即可。

2.8K10
  • Spark Tips 2: Spark Streaming均匀分配Kafka directStream 读出的数据

    下面这段code用于Spark Streaming job读取Kafka的message: .........具体看16个worker(executorinstance)的log,会发现,同一个duration,只有2个worker在运行。于是加入上面红色一行代码,发现rddPartitionNum是2。...strJavaRDD一共只有2个partition,所有,每次只有2个worker工作。 为什么strJavaRDD只有2个partition呢?...因为Kafka配置的default partition number只有2个,创建topic的时候,没有制定专门的partitionnumber,所以采用了defaultpartition number...可是向新生成的topicpublishmessage之后却发现,并不是所有partition中都有数据。显然publish到Kafka的数据没有平均分布。

    1.5K70

    2开始,Go语言后端业务系统引入缓存

    本次我们接着上两篇文章进行讲解《0开始,用Go语言搭建一个简单的后端业务系统》和《1开始,扩展Go语言后端业务系统的RPC功能》,如题,需求就是为了应对查询时的高qps,我们引入Redis缓存,让查询数据时不直接将请求发送到数据库...,而是先通过一层缓存来抵挡qps,下面我们开始今天的分享:1 逻辑设计图片如图,本次缓存设计的逻辑就是查询时首先查询缓存,如果查询不到则查询数据库(实际不建议,会发生缓存穿透),增删改时会先改数据库...2 代码2.1 项目结构图片2.2 下载依赖go get github.com/go-redis/redis/v82.3 具体代码和配置配置:package configimport ( "fmt"...NumInfo) UnmarshalBinary(data []byte) error { return json.Unmarshal(data, &info)}4 总结引入Redis缓存是后端业务应对高并发查询比较常见的一个做法...,软件工程学中有一句话叫做:计算机的所有问题都可以用加一层来解决。

    21800

    「React TS3 专题」创建第一个 React TypeScript3 项目开始

    Studio Code 编辑器里安装扩展( Ctrl + Shift + X ),左上角的搜索框输入tslint: ?...二、手动创建 手动创建步骤比较繁杂,但是能够0~1的那种体验,还是蛮有成就感的。...-8"/> 我们React应用程序的内容将会注入到...11、创建启动和构建脚本 11.1 、启动应用程序 接下来我们使用npm命令启动我们的应用程序,一个用于开发模式,一个用于生产打包模式,你可以修改 package.json scripts 属性对应的内容部分...11.3、开发环境预览 接下来我们输入以下命令,开发模式下进行预览: npm start 11.4、打开浏览器 接下来我们浏览器里进行访问,浏览器输入 http://localhost:9000

    2.2K10

    Angular的12个经典问题,看看你能答对几个?(文末附带Angular测试)

    Angular2,组件中发生的任何改变总是当前组件传播到其所有子组件。如果一个子组件的更改需要反映到其父组件的层次结构,我们可以通过使用事件发射器api来发出事件。...Codelyzer运行在tslint的顶部,其编码约定通常在tslint.json文件定义。Codelyzer可以直接通过Angularcli或npm运行。...要在Visual Studio代码设置codelyzer,我们可以文件 - >选项 - >用户设置添加tslint规则的路径。.../node_modules/codelyzer", "typescript.tsdk": "node_modules/typescript/lib" } cli运行的代码:ng lint...Angular 2应用,我们应该注意哪些安全威胁? 就像任何其他客户端或Web应用程序一样,Angular 2应用程序也应该遵循一些基本准则来减轻安全风险。

    17.3K80

    SPDY到HTTP2:Google的革命性协议及其Go的应用

    我们每天都在与互联网打交道,浏览器、网站和应用程序是我们连接世界的桥梁。但是,你是否曾经停下来想过,这背后的技术是如何运作的呢?...今天,我们将探讨Google发明的SPDY协议以及其HTTP/2的重要作用,并用Go语言演示如何创建一个HTTP/2服务器。...HTTP/2的核心目标之一是提高Web性能,这与SPDY的目标非常相似。事实上,HTTP/2的许多关键特性(例如多路复用、二进制协议、头部压缩等)都是直接SPDY协议借鉴过来的。...所以,我们可以说HTTP/2很大程度上就是SPDY的进化版。 Go创建HTTP/2服务器 Go语言因其出色的性能和并发支持而在网络编程备受青睐。以下是一个简单的Go语言HTTP/2服务器示例。...尽管SPDY已被HTTP/2取代,但它在HTTP/2的设计和开发过程起到了关键的作用。通过Go语言,我们可以轻松地建立HTTP/2服务器,从而充分利用HTTP/2为我们带来的性能优势。

    50720

    tslint pre-commit 配置教程

    tslint(jshint,eslint原理都类似),因为项目中我们会经常忘记主动的去做代码检查,虽然结合webpack各种构建工具下,存在*slint报错,项目会跑不起来。...git hooks 配置tslint pre commit之前,首先需要了解git hooks,正如它的名字所示,这是一个关于git 操作的钩子,比如我们想要在做远程仓库推送时,那就会触发pre-push...这个钩子,然后在这个钩子写下自己想做的事。...git hooks的配置就在项目.git文件夹下面的hooks文件夹写相关的钩子函数时,需要注意的是,将钩子后面的sample后缀去掉,代码才会生效。.../bin/bash TSLINT="$(git rev-parse --show-toplevel)/node_modules/.bin/tslint" for file in $(git diff -

    1.3K30

    【Weex一瞥笔记】

    观察发现,都是weexpack里面的,而且居然写死了名字!也就是说修改配置文件,这里都不会动态变化,同时用Android Studio打开,包名也是固定死是:com.weex.app。...目录结构 首先比较下weex和ionic的目录,两者还是有点像的,只是weex把ionic隐藏在node_modules里面的wabpack配置开放出来了,这样配置起来就灵活了一些。...weex ionic weex ionic 2. UI weex好像自身不带UI框架,但是可以很简单地集成weex-ui,而ionic自带UI,两者打个平手吧。...此外weex基于vue2+,ionic基于angular2+,都是比较热门的框架,所以组件这方面两者都不用愁。 3....页面展示 weex有单页和多页面方式,直观就是一个webview显示所有页面,另一个是多个webview各显示一个页面,而ionic只有单webview显示,所以某种情况来说,多webview时,weex

    2.2K30

    React Native工程TSLint静态检查工具的探索之路

    一、使用TSLint的原因 客户端团队进入React Native项目的开发过程,面临着如下问题: 由于大家客户端转入到React Native开发过程,容易出现低级语法错误; 开发者之前从事Android...三、如何进行TSLint规则配置与检查 首先,工程package.json文件配置TSLint包: ? 根目录tslint.json文件可以根据需要配置已有规则,例如: ?.../node_modules/.bin/)即为: ..../node_modules/.bin/tslint --project tsconfig.json --config tslint.json 从而会提示出类似以下错误的信息: src/Components...总结 TSLint的优点: 速度快。相对于动态代码检查,检查速度较快,现有项目无论是本地检查,还是CI检查,对于由十余个页面组成的React Native工程,可以1到2分钟内完成; 灵活。

    2.7K20

    【前端配置篇】vue项目之.env系列文件配置详解:.env文件配置全局环境变量

    文章目录 ♈️.env 文件配置 1️⃣ 文件说明 2️⃣ 内容格式 3️⃣ 加载 4️⃣ 优先级 5️⃣ 项目中的使用 总结 ☀️ 文章推荐 ♈️.env 文件配置 1️⃣ 文件说明 .env:全局默认配置文件...2️⃣ 内容格式 注意:属性名必须以 VUE_APP_ 开头,如:VUE_APP_XXX 3️⃣ 加载 vue 会根据启动命令自动加载相对应的环境配置文件。...package.json里面配置好,执行serve的时候用开发环境的。.../tslint.json 'src/**/*{.ts,.tsx}'" } .env.development的文件。....env 的全局属性 VUE_APP_AGE 被保留。 5️⃣ 项目中的使用 配置文件定义的属性在其它文件如何访问呢?? 可以使用 process.env.xxx 来访问属性。

    12.7K21

    如何在 Windows 上安装 Angular:Angular CLI、Node.js 和构建工具指南

    本例,Node.js 用于构建应用程序的后端部分,并且可以替换为您想要的任何服务器端技术,例如 PHP、Ruby 或 Python。...有很多方法可以做到这一点,例如: 使用 NVM(Node版本管理器)系统安装和使用多个版本的node 使用对应的操作系统的官方包管理器 官方网站安装它。 让我们保持简单并使用官方网站。...build (b): 将 Angular 应用程序编译到给定输出路径上名为 dist/ 的输出目录。必须工作空间目录执行。 config: 检索或设置 Angular 配置值。...我们看看各个文件的作用: /e2e/:包含网站的端到端(模拟用户行为)测试 /node_modules/:使用 npm install 将所有 3rd 方库安装到此文件夹 /src/:包含应用程序的源代码...:TSlint(静态分析工具)的配置文件 为您的项目服务 Angular CLI 提供了一个完整的工具链,用于本地计算机上开发前端应用程序

    47600
    领券